Ocho Munna is a talented rapper hailing from the south side of Chicago, known for his gritty lyrics and raw storytelling. Born on December 29, 1995, in the heart of Chicago, he was exposed to the harsh realities of street life from a young age. Growing up in a tough neighborhood, Ocho Munna found solace in music, using it as an outlet to express his struggles and aspirations.
Despite the challenges he faced growing up, Ocho Munna remained determined to pursue his passion for music. Inspired by the sounds of drill rap, he began writing lyrics and honing his craft at a young age. His hard-hitting verses and introspective rhymes quickly caught the attention of local audiences, propelling him into the spotlight as a promising new talent in the Chicago music scene.
As a member of the drill rap group OBMG, Ocho Munna solidified his place in the industry, collaborating with fellow artists and carving out a unique sound for himself. His debut mixtape, "Grind: The Mixtape," showcased his lyrical prowess and distinctive style, earning him a dedicated following of fans.
Despite his success, Ocho Munna's journey has not been without its challenges. Growing up in a neighborhood plagued by violence and poverty, he faced adversity at every turn. His former stage name, Oblock Ocho, was a nod to his ties to the O-Block set of the Black Disciples gang, a reality that shaped his experiences and informed his music.
Throughout his career, Ocho Munna has faced personal hardships, including the loss of friends and loved ones to street violence. The tragic death of his close friend and fellow rapper LA Capone served as a wake-up call, reminding him of the dangers inherent in the lifestyle he was living.
